研究结论

Date Results Publications
2020-06-06 12:29:00 EXO70H4 is involved in stomatal and apoplastic defenses in Arabidopsis and suggest that EXO70H4-mediated defense play a distinct role in guard cells and leaf mesophyll cells in a bacteria-dependent manner. EXO70H4 contributes to callose deposition in response to both human and plant pathogens. 31914927
2020-01-11 12:14:00 While the apical domain recruits EXO70H4, the basal domain recruits EXO70A1, which corresponds to the lipid-binding capacities of these two paralogs. Loss of EXO70H4 results in a loss of the Ortmannian ring border and decreased apical PA accumulation, which causes the PA and PIP2 domains to merge together. 31382643
2019-01-12 11:56:00 both EXO70H4- and PMR4-dependent callose deposition in the trichome are essential for cell wall silicification. 29301954
2016-04-16 10:14:00 EXO70H4-dependent trichome cell wall hardening is a unique phenomenon, which may be conserved among a variety of the land plants. 25767057
